Is D'Hanis a Good Place to Live?
Economy & Jobs
D'Hanis residents earn a median household income of $42,083 , which is 44% below the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$17,764. The unemployment rate stands at 5.8% (61%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 17.9%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 898 business establishments, including 90 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in D'Hanis is $54,200 , 81%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$256,828. Median rent is $1,295/month, with 51.0%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 97.1 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1998.
Safety & Crime
D'Hanis reports 365 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 4%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 3,162/100K.
Education
13.5% of adults in D'Hanis hold a bachelor's degree or higher (60% below the national average). 91.6% have completed high school. Local schools score 5.3/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
D'Hanis has an average annual temperature of 70°F (21°C). Winters average 52°F in January while summers reach 85°F in July. The area gets 312 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 24.9 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 42.
